How does proper ventilation help in controlling dust in barns?

Proper ventilation in barns is crucial for controlling dust, ensuring a healthier environment for animals and workers. By effectively managing airflow, barns can reduce dust accumulation, improve air quality, and minimize respiratory issues.

Why is Ventilation Important in Barns?

Ventilation plays a vital role in maintaining barn air quality. Proper ventilation systems help to:

  • Reduce airborne dust: By circulating air, ventilation systems prevent dust from settling.
  • Control humidity: Proper airflow helps maintain optimal humidity levels, reducing dust formation.
  • Remove pollutants: Ventilation helps expel harmful gases and particles, such as ammonia and dust, improving overall air quality.

How Does Ventilation Control Dust in Barns?

1. Airflow Patterns and Dust Reduction

Airflow patterns are essential in minimizing dust levels. Ventilation systems create consistent air movement, which disperses dust particles and prevents them from settling on surfaces.

  • Cross ventilation: This method involves placing openings on opposite walls, allowing fresh air to flow through and carry dust away.
  • Mechanical ventilation: Fans and duct systems can be used to create controlled airflow, ensuring uniform dust removal.

2. Humidity Control and Its Impact on Dust

Humidity levels influence dust accumulation. High humidity can cause dust to clump and settle, while low humidity can make dust more airborne.

  • Ventilation systems help maintain balanced humidity levels, reducing dust formation.
  • Misting systems can be integrated to add moisture, preventing dust from becoming airborne.

3. Filtration Systems and Dust Management

Filtration systems are effective in trapping dust particles before they circulate in the barn.

  • Air filters: These capture dust and other particles, ensuring cleaner air.
  • Regular maintenance: Cleaning and replacing filters regularly enhances their efficiency in dust control.

How Often Should Barn Ventilation Systems Be Inspected?

Barn ventilation systems should be inspected at least twice a year to ensure they function efficiently. Regular inspections help identify issues such as clogged filters or malfunctioning fans, which can hinder dust control.

What Are the Health Benefits of Proper Barn Ventilation?

Proper barn ventilation reduces dust and harmful gases, leading to better respiratory health for animals and workers. It minimizes the risk of respiratory diseases and improves overall well-being.

Can Ventilation Systems Be Customized for Different Barn Types?

Yes, ventilation systems can be tailored to suit various barn designs and sizes. Customization ensures optimal airflow and dust control, considering specific needs and environmental conditions.

What Are the Signs of Poor Ventilation in Barns?

Signs of poor ventilation include excessive dust buildup, strong odors, high humidity, and visible condensation. These indicators suggest the need for improved airflow and dust management.

How Does Ventilation Impact Animal Productivity?

Good ventilation enhances animal comfort and health, leading to increased productivity. Animals in well-ventilated barns experience less stress and are less prone to illnesses, resulting in better growth and performance.
